Teachers in secondary education, both sexes (number), annual growth in Jamaica
Jamaica: Teachers in secondary education, both sexes (number), annual growth was -11.98 % change on previous year in 2024. ◆ Volatile
Teachers in secondary education, both sexes (number), annual growth in Jamaica, 1985–2024
Source: Statizoid (derived). Measured in % change on previous year.
Analysis
The most recent figure for teachers in secondary education, both sexes (number), annual growth in Jamaica is -11.98 % change on previous year, measured in 2024.
That represents a change of down 1,461.5% on the previous year and down 194.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, teachers in secondary education, both sexes (number), annual growth in Jamaica peaked at 17.48 % change on previous year in 2022 and was at its lowest, -16.94 % change on previous year, in 2021.
That places Jamaica 196th out of 205 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
The year-on-year percentage change in Teachers in secondary education, both sexes (number). Computed from consecutive annual observations; years either side of a gap are skipped rather than bridged.
Computed from
- Teachers in secondary education, both sexes UNESCO Institute for Statistics
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
